Haiti’s initiative to open a canal branching off the Massacre River is all over the news. According to the Miami Herald, the closure of the 220-mile border between the Dominican Republic and Haiti has been attributed to concerns over constructing a canal branching off the Massacre River on the Haitian side. The river has its source at Pico Gallo in the Dominican Republic. The Dominicans have expressed dissatisfaction with the canal's engineering, claiming that it is inadequately designed and causing the diversion of crucial water resources necessary for agricultural irrigation in both nations. The government of Abinader also has mentioned that it believes “the canal is a maneuver to control water by a small economic-political elite to profit from its sale to small producers in the area.

The two nations sharing the island are separated by a long river basin that traverses national boundaries, and instances of historical tensions or conflicts between Haiti and the DR have further intensified due to the former’s decision to build the canal.   For more than three decades, we have seen side-by-side satellite images comparing the two nations. Although these pictures can be misleading, the current conflict opened our eyes and brought evidence of non-irrigation's role in the comparison. It begs the question, is Haiti less green due to a lack of water resources? The conventional wisdom points to deforestation for the charcoal market. However, Haiti has a drier climate, with mountains blocking rains coming from the east. As a mountainous country, Haiti has fewer valleys and a smaller footprint for large-scale agriculture. Limestone terrain is abundant, and the soil recovers much slower for goods production. The rivers delineating the border between the two nations flow more significantly on the Dominican side. The post-construction phase is one aspect the Haitians do not widely discuss on social media. At HAMREC, we beg to have a comprehensive plan in place.  It is a known fact that a canal branching off a river can lead to flooding under certain conditions. While the purpose of the Massacre River canal is to irrigate nearby agricultural land, several factors can contribute to massive flooding. Excessive or prolonged rainfall, blockages, inadequate maintenance, design flaws, upstream urban development, and land use can alter the natural flow of water. Increased urbanization can lead to more runoff, which can overwhelm the canal system levee. Failures, Inadequate Spillways: Canals are often equipped with spillways to release excess water during heavy rainfall. If these spillways are too small or blocked, it can lead to flooding. Unpredictable and intense weather events, such as hurricanes or flash floods, can overwhelm canal systems and lead to flooding, even if they are well-maintained.

Perform Studies

According to FEMA, Channels and canals are artificial structures that use the force of gravity to transport water for various purposes, such as flood prevention, drainage, irrigation, and water delivery. Aqueducts include different infrastructure elements, such as pipes, ditches, canals, tunnels, and other buildings, which transport water. As such, these systems have vulnerabilities and are prone to causing damage to surrounding areas during hurricanes and heavy rains if there are no strategies to mitigate these factors.

A study of soil erosion, water strength, gradient slope, and incline pitch needs to be performed. Water erosion is the process by which soil is detached and transported by water, displacing the eroded materials from their original location. The erosive impact of rainfall on soil results in water-related processes such as stream erosion, which subsequently contribute to downstream consequences such as floods and sediment accumulation.

Welthunger reports that “the average soil loss observed in the 400 square kilometers of the watersheds of the three rivers Jassa, Lamatry, and Rio Massacre is close to 150 tons per hectare per year, although this varies greatly and can even get as high as 12,770 tons.” 

Strength in Unity: Building a model for more to come.

Haitians' propensity to unite to undertake important endeavors that successfully provide collective benefits is a phenomenon to be expected. Historically and culturally, a “kombit” involves the collaborative efforts of males engaging in physically demanding tasks like excavation and heavy lifting while women and children concurrently participate in sowing seeds. The concept of togetherness among Haitian families evokes their spiritual and fraternal sentiments. This event allows individuals to sing, consume beverages, partake in culinary delights, and engage in cheerful banter. The harvested produce is then distributed to all the individuals involved.

There needs to be a national convention to protect and regulate the resource. Rivers flowing within the western side of the border are a resource protected by Article 35.5 of the 1987 Haitian constitution. A miserly DINEPA budget of less than 1% is currently dedicated to managing, caring for, and preserving water in Haiti. More money needs to be allocated. The Haitian government's participation should ensure that the current irrigation systems can use more of the region's water safely and cost-effectively. The canal will require continuous investments in labor. Maintenance and operation costs of the canal and its arteries will require regular upkeep. We must be ready to deal with more mosquitoes in the area and diseases from those who use the water for cooking and drinking. Conflicts may arise among Haitians about who gets more water. The most affluent owners will always win the fight. Another issue that will arise is sediment and trash in the canal, causing blockages and accumulating damaging salts and alkalis from deeper levels to the surface.
